- As of today (August 17, 2025), LPL annual free cash flow is -$370.12 million, with the most recent change of +$1.52 billion (+80.44%) on December 31, 2024.
- During the last 3 years, LPL annual FCF has fallen by -$2.10 billion (-121.44%).
- LPL annual FCF is now -120.26% below its all-time high of $1.83 billion, reached on December 31, 2007.
